Our Django development services already power dozens of engagements. We typically land our teams within 2 weeks, so you can start shipping top-quality software fast.
Create feature-rich, faster web apps with improved security. Django is the favorite Python framework for web development, with libraries like Django Oscar, Django Allauth, and Celery, as well as a variety of utilities like object-relational mapping. These tools are used by our developers to create dependable user experiences for web apps.
Use Django to grow, personalize, and add features to eCommerce and mCommerce stores, such as payment gateways. Because to Django's vast libraries, security features, and modular design, we are able to create online stores that are easy to use and responsive. We can integrate features like inventory management and other crucial eCommerce services with the aid of tools and modules like Django SHOP and Saleor.
Use Django to create user-friendly and intuitive web interfaces that improve user experiences for customers. Our developers use frameworks like Angular and React.js to produce aesthetically pleasing and useful web interfaces. With the help of Django Templates, Webpack, Django Widget Tweaks, and other tools, we create logical navigation features, captivating visual components, and responsive layouts.
Web apps with adaptable and effective interfaces are more visually appealing and captivating. Using Django, we provide RESTful APIs that facilitate smooth data flow and communication. To create, secure, and manage RESTful APIs in Django, we make use of the Django Rest Framework (DRF), which includes its serializer, viewsets and generic views, and API documentation generators.
Django's templates serve as the framework for the user interface and are used to generate dynamic HTML pages and content. Resulting layouts that are both aesthetically pleasing and easy to use. We create dynamic, user-friendly, and captivating web interfaces by utilizing Django Template Language in conjunction with tags, filters, and other features.
Since years, we’ve helped over 500 clients build custom tech solutions. Our 4,000+ team members are well-versed in hundreds of technologies. From Django, Kotlin, and Dart to machine learning, app development, and data engineering, our specialties span the gamut of technologies and niches.
Three forms of engagement are available. As part of staff augmentation, our developers are integrated with current teams. This gives you access to more team members or specialized skills. Businesses are able to employ complete development teams using our dedicated teams approach. If you want to delegate a whole project, software outsourcing is a great choice.
All-inclusive web development tools that offer frontend and backend functionality right out of the box.
Frameworks and tools that are specifically designed for building web APIs, enabling the creation of reliable and expandable server-side applications.
frameworks and systems that offer tools and interfaces for managing, creating, and querying databases inside of web applications.
frameworks for creating online applications that make use of the semantic web's tenets, enabling the creation of relationally complex and data-driven web services.
Django speeds up the process by which developers may create robust web apps. Django cuts down on development time and effort with features like an admin interface, URL routing, and ORM. Along with effective software delivery, it also gives priority to security and scalability.
Django is used to swiftly create scalable and maintainable online applications. The strong foundation is perfect for building sophisticated, data-driven websites and projects, ranging from scientific computing applications to social networks and content management systems.
Businesses with established development teams might consider staff augmentation. Do you want to get specialized talent and shorten timelines? Your internal team and our Django developers will work together seamlessly. Together, we'll boost output and quickly deploy your software. This is how we strengthen your team:
We begin by inquiring about your goals, financial constraints, schedules, and necessary skill sets. This will enable us to identify the most suitable talent for your group.
The Django developers that best suit your team will be selected by us. Along with technical proficiency and background, we'll also take soft skills and cultural fit into account.
We'll help you with the onboarding process for your new employees. They'll quickly catch up and begin to accelerate your plan. You will then have the authority to lead and grow the team as you see fit.
In search of a complete team? If you require specialized talent in addition to Django developers, such as QA and DevOps, dedicated teams are the ideal solution for you. These experts will collaborate with your internal scrum master or project manager. Here's how to assemble a committed team:
We'll inquire about your objectives, business, and Django software development requirements. We can create the ideal team for you with the use of this information.
We'll assemble a group of knowledgeable Django developers together with other experts. We'll locate the offshore talent that best fits your needs and corporate culture.
Your hardworking team is prepared to start after we collaborate with you to onboard the new members. You'll be in complete charge and supervision. As required, scale and manage the crew.
We find out more about your company, needs, objectives, schedule, and finances here. We will also inquire about the specific skill sets that you require.
We'll assemble a team with every specialized position you require. We will also assign a project manager to keep your Django development efforts on track. We'll design a strategy and pick the right tools to support you in reaching your objectives.
After integrating the team members, we'll go to work. We will keep you updated and informed about our progress even while we work independently. Additionally, you can scale or make adjustments as necessary.
Because of its scalable architecture, Django is a great option for projects with a lot of traffic. It makes use of load balancers and cloud services, and provides a range of scalability options, such as database optimization and caching techniques. When these tools are used together, the framework is dependable and effective at managing high user loads and traffic volumes.
Django's integrated features, which include defense against CSRF, SQL injections, XSS assaults, and other threats, enhance the security of web applications. It also provides regular updates to fix newly found vulnerabilities or threats and aids in ensuring safe permissions and user authentication management.
In terms of actual expenses and personnel efforts, the Django framework helps businesses save money. Team productivity is maximized by its open-source nature, rapid development assistance, and decreased requirement for complex organic coding. Teams can reduce total project expenses by using Django web development services to improve resource utilization and developer productivity.
Django offers pre-built solutions for a variety of common web development jobs, allowing for quicker development and a shorter time to market for new online applications. It has an extensive library collection, robust community support, and an easy-to-use admin interface.
Businesses should prioritize having a Django development company with experience with both Python and the Django framework. Strong client references, a portfolio of accomplished Django and Pythion projects, and, if feasible, client interviews should be taken into account as well. For a long-term collaboration to succeed, it's also critical to make sure the Django services partner is in line with your communication style and processes.